The samurai series 'Shogun' garnered a historic 18 Emmy Awards, including Outstanding Drama Series. Hiroyuki Sanada became the first Japanese actor to win Best Lead Actor in a dramatic series, with co-star Anna Sawai achieving a similar milestone for Best Actress. The awards highlight the influence of Japan's 'jidaigeki' samurai films and mark a significant moment in the entertainment industry.
The one-off Test match between Afghanistan and New Zealand in Greater Noida was completely abandoned due to persistent rain and a soggy outfield, marking the first such incident in 91 years in Asia. Despite attempts to ready the pitch, heavy rainfall over the past week rendered it unplayable. This makes it the eighth Test match in history to be abandoned without a ball being bowled.

Liverpool achieved a commanding 3-0 triumph over Manchester United in a Premier League clash at Old Trafford, showcasing their dominance under new manager Arne Slot. The game featured two goals from Luis Díaz and a finish by Mohamed Salah, further solidifying Slot's exceptional start to the season with Liverpool, who now sit second in the Premier League standings.
Chidimma Adetshina has emerged as Miss Universe Nigeria 2024, overcoming competition from 24 other contestants in Lagos. Born in Soweto and representing Taraba State, Adetshina had faced controversy in the Miss South Africa 2024 pageant but was undeterred in her quest for the Nigerian crown. She will now represent Nigeria at Miss Universe in Mexico in November 2024.
